Outside of his successful MMA career, Conor McGregor recently expanded his horizons by entering into films with 2024’s Road House. Many pointed out his deliberately over-the-top performance as one of the highlights of the film. The film is already a big hit on Amazon (with 50 million views over its first two weekends of release via Deadline), making his film transition a success.

Advertisement

McGregor has been claiming that he is now the highest-paid debut actor in Hollywood while promoting the film. While McGregor’s exact salary for the film is unknown, industry insiders estimate that he earned more than the previous record holder Dwayne Johnson, who received $5.5 million for his debut role in The Mummy Returns (via Screenrant).

Now, McGregor is entering another arena in combat sports as he recently announced on Instagram, that he would be the owner of Bare Knuckle Fighting Championships (BKFC). In addition to expressing his excitement about his new career move, he gave a shout out to BKFC president David Feldman in his post. McGregor said,

“The Notorious Conor McGregor here. Ladies and gentlemen, the huge announcement that I have for you today, Conor McGregor myself, and McGregor Sports and Entertainment is now an owner of Bare Knuckle Fighting Championships. Welcome to the big leagues. David Feldman, baby, we did it.”

BKFC Is a Whole Another Challenge than UFC/MMA

Bare-knuckle fighting is similar to boxing but it is a more bloody and intense version of it. While MMA fighters use gloves and can use several moves to inflict damage on the opponent, players do not use padded gloves in bare-knuckle fighting. However, fighters do get serious lacerations and damage to the face.

While UFC fighters can end a match by submission, Bare-knuckle fighting goes all the way till the opponent gets totally knocked out (equivalent to a last-man-standing match). Unlike MMA, bare-knuckle fighters are aware of the limitations of not wearing gloves, thus the room for creativity and unique moves is scarce.

Advertisement

The BKFC has been slowly riding up in popularity since its promotion in 2018 led by David Feldman. In its promotion year, the company made only $500,000 in revenue. By 2024, its brand value has skyrocketed to $411 million (via Rolling Stone). While it has a long way to go to reach the heights of the UFC, it is already a successful venture. The upcoming BKFC: Knucklemania IV event on April 27, 2024, is set to be headlined by the match between Mike Perry and Thiago Alves.

Conor McGregor made his film debut recently in Doug Liman’s Road House, a reimagining of the 1989 film of the same name starring Patrick Swayze. Jake Gyllenhaal took on the role of Dalton from Swayze and the two actors had very intense and physically demanding scenes throughout the film.

In an interview with The Mac Life. McGregor revealed that he was initially not sure how making a film would be or whether he would like the experience of it. However, as he got deep into the filming process, he was in awe of the hard work that everyone put into the film and the ‘movie magic’ of it all. McGregor enjoyed every second of shooting the film as he told the outlet,

Advertisement

“I was just in awe of it all, to be honest with you, the whole process. I didn’t know how I was going to take to it,” he continued. “I didn’t know whether I was going to like it, to be honest. I’m a fighting man – that’s my bread and butter. It’s where I come from… I’m not an actor, but I’m show business. That was my vibe to it. I felt that. I enjoyed every second of it.”

McGregor clearly had a lot of fun playing the role and it seemed he retained his cheeky and wild personality for the role of Knox. McGregor will soon be heading back to the octagon as he is set to face off against Michael Chandler at UFC 303 on June 29, 2024, at the T-Mobile Arena in Paradise, Nevada.
